    I did a ton of research before purchasing my Apple Watch. I was uncertain if I wanted to spend $350 on something that I didn't really need, knowing that a newer model is more than likely going to be released in a few months. However, the decision became a lot easier when Best Buy dropped the price to $250 for the Sport 38mm Rose Gold watch. I decided to purchase it and see if I liked it. Now that I have it, I love it. First, it's so pretty, with the rose gold watch and lilac band. It matches with pretty much everything, between the black face, rose gold frame, and lilac band (which is a very muted but pretty color). Second, I love the ability to customize it. While I don't use all the features on my watch, it is enough of an upgrade from my Fitbit Charge HR (although it doesn't track my sleep, something the newer generation Watch is rumored to do) that I am very pleased with the purchase. While my husband questioned why I didn't just wait for the new model, I am not at all disappointed. I don't find myself needing a watch that has all of the features of my 6s Plus iPhone (although I know that is what some people want). While I'm sure the next generation will have some cool upgrades, this watch was reasonably priced and has enough features for me to be pleased without feeling like I need to upgrade it as soon as the new one comes out. I did some research on apps offered through the Apple Store that also have Apple Watch capability. A few of the apps that are great on Apple Watch include: Shazam, Find Near Me, Dark Sky, and Yummly. Don't expect the Apple Watch to be an iPhone (you do need to charge the watch every night and it's not as fast as a phone, obviously) and you won't be disappointed. If you like technology and find having gadgets fun, I think you will enjoy this. If you like something that you can customize to fit your personality (watch faces, watch bands, apps, activities, etc.), you should like the Apple Watch. I know I do!

    I have never liked wearing a watch. I work on cars a lot and they're always just in the way. Plus I have small wrists and the watches tend to slide up and down my arms constantly which drives me nuts. This watch however fits beautifully. It's just snug enough. The thing I like best about it is the fitness app. I do IT work so I sit constantly, and it's constantly reminding me to stand up and move. I had a fitbit before, but this seems to work much better for me. You can answer texts via talk to text, and I can answer my phone while driving from the watch. I can view the weather from it as well. Very happy so far. People mentioned the battery life and yes, you do have to charge it daily, however I got a stand for my night stand that holds the charger so I just pop it off and lay it on that before bedtime. typically, i'm about 60% by the end of the day, but not enough charge to go 2 days.
